When it comes to home renovations or remodelling projects, one of the most labour-intensive and time-consuming tasks is removing the existing flooring. Whether you’re upgrading your carpets to hardwood, replacing worn-out tiles, or simply giving your space a fresh new look, proper flooring removal is crucial.

I. Understanding the Importance of Professional Flooring Removal

a. Protecting Your Property:

Flooring removal often involves heavy machinery, tools, and techniques that can potentially damage your property. Professional services are equipped with the necessary tools and expertise to protect your walls, furniture, and other valuable assets during the removal process.

b. Ensuring Safety:

Flooring removal can be hazardous, particularly when dealing with materials like asbestos or old adhesives. Professionals have the knowledge and experience to handle these situations safely, minimising the risk of health hazards or accidents.

c. Efficient Waste Disposal:

Proper disposal of old flooring materials is essential for environmental reasons. Professional removal services have established processes for responsible waste disposal, ensuring compliance with local regulations and minimising your ecological impact.

II. Benefits of Hiring Flooring Removal Services

a. Time and Effort Savings:

Removing flooring requires meticulous planning, physical labour, and the use of specialised equipment. By hiring professionals, you can save valuable time and energy that can be better invested in other aspects of your renovation project.

b. Seamless Surface Preparation:

Flooring removal services go beyond removing the flooring itself. They can also address issues like subfloor preparation, levelling, and ensuring a clean, smooth surface for the new flooring installation. This attention to detail can greatly enhance the final outcome.

c. Expertise and Skill:

Flooring removal specialists possess the knowledge, skills, and experience to handle a wide range of flooring materials, including hardwood, carpet, vinyl, and tiles. Their expertise ensures a professional and efficient removal process, minimising the risk of damage to your property.

III. How to Choose the Right Flooring Removal Service

a. Research and Reputation:

Start by researching local flooring removal services and read customer reviews or testimonials. Look for companies with a strong reputation for reliability, professionalism, and customer satisfaction.

b. Experience and Expertise:

Consider the experience and expertise of the removal service. Find out how long they have been in business and inquire about their specific experience in removing the type of flooring you have.

c. Licensing and Insurance:

Ensure that the removal service is properly licensed and insured. This protects you from any liability in case of accidents or damages during the removal process.

d. Transparent Pricing:

Request detailed quotes from multiple removal services to compare their pricing structures. Beware of overly cheap or inflated prices, and opt for a service that offers a fair and transparent pricing model.
